 Antidepressants is the tenth studio album by English (from London) "Britpop era" alternative rock post punk art band Suede, released on September 5, 2025. Producer Ed Buller. Commercially, it debuted on the UK Albums Chart at number 2, and charted in the top 40 of several other countries and territories. It is their first Number 1 album in 26 years.A dense album with no real weak points, and that's what's so remarkable.

Worst Case Scenario is the debut studio album by Belgian (based in Antwerp) alternative experimental art indie rock band dEUS, released on September 16, 1994. Producer Peter Vermeersch - Pierre Vervloesem. Worst Case Scenario received good reviews internationally and it reached Gold in Belgium.


In a Bar, Under the Sea is the second studio album (
followed two years later, similar in style to its predecessor). by Belgian (based in Antwerp) alternative experimental art indie rock band dEUS, released on September 16, 1996. Producer Eric Drew Feldman (who was keyboard and bass player for Captain Beefheart in the late seventies and early eighties). In a Bar, Under the Sea reached Gold in Belgium.
